Best districts for dinner and a walk
Date nightCoconut Grove
One of the easiest meal-plus-walk answers on the site.
Polished and low-frictionCoral Gables
Dependable when you want polish and lower friction.
Urban movementBrickell
Best for a more urban dinner-and-stroll version.
Visitor atmosphereMiami Beach
Strongest when ocean air and atmosphere are part of the point.
Browse-heavy eveningWynwood and Midtown
Useful when browsing and visual energy matter as much as the meal.
What usually works best
One meal, one short walk, one optional add-on
The point is not maximizing stops. The point is choosing a district where the next step feels obvious.
